Though Roughton Road doesn't boast expansive facilities, it ensures convenience with key amenities. The station is equipped with ticket machines where travelers can purchase and collect tickets bought online. However, there's no staffed ticket office, and those requiring assistance may need to plan accordingly. An induction loop is available for those with hearing impairments.
Accessibility at this station is a consideration, given that step-free access is not available. The station involves a steep flight of steps and a ramp to reach the platform, which might not be suitable for everyone. Passengers who require step-free access should head to nearby Cromer station, located just over a mile away.
When it comes to onward travel, Roughton Road provides options despite its size. Replacement bus services, when necessary, operate from the station's entrance on Roughton Road. However, options like local taxis or car hire services are not readily available directly from the station; travelers might need to pre-arrange such services to ensure a smooth journey.

Although modest in size, Busby Train Station is equipped to cater to your basic travel needs. There is no ticket office; however, ticket machines are available for collecting your tickets, including those purchased online. These machines are accessible for all passengers. For hearing-impaired travelers, induction loops are provided. While there is no staff assistance on site, information is readily available through help points and customer service channels. The absence of luggage storage, shopping outlets, and refreshment stands means planning ahead is essential for a comfortable journey.
The station boasts partial step-free access. Though platforms are connected by a footbridge with stairs, wider step-free paths are available. However, travelers should take extra care at certain parts of Platform 2 where stepping distances to trains can vary.
It's seamless to reach your desired location from Busby, thanks to diverse transport links. The station is well supported by local bus services, detailed information for which can be found on www.travelinescotland.com or by calling 0871 200 22 33 at any hour. The bus facilities are complemented by a designated rail replacement bus pick-up and drop-off spot conveniently situated at the station entrance on Busby Road. For those requiring taxi services, the website www.traintaxi.co.uk provides valuable data.
